A quick Google search indicates that while overall inflation since 2008 is roughly 50% (meaning a $33 billion project ought to be roughly $50 billion), concrete prices have tripled during that same time. This single-handedly explains much of the cost increase.

Also, getting back to the Made-in-USA requirement, it might be the case that steel rail prices have not inflated internationally (I could not find a statistic), but the cost to buy even 50% of the rail domestically might be much, much higher.

I have personal knowledge of a streetcar project with Made-in-USA mandates that resulted in them laying much heavier and expensive rail than the streetcars require.

Sometimes prices unexpectedly crash. If this project had been approved in 2004, they would have gotten to the construction phase just as the 2008 collapse commenced. They would have been able to get far cheaper labor and materials. For example, I just looked up steel fencing costs and apparently fencing costs crashed 75% during that recession. Almost every mile of construction in the Central Valley will require two miles of very high-quality fencing. If you've ever gotten a quote on fencing for your house, you would know that fencing alone might comprise hundreds of millions of dollars or even a billion of CAHSR's budget.
